The ''Diligence''-class light destroyer entered service within the [[CMA Navy]] in [[2433]]. Originally classified as a cruiser, the ''Diligence''-class was eventually reclassified as a destroyer as ships grew in firepower and mass. Starting in [[2496]], the class was fitted with two powerful outrigger [[Magnetic Accelerator Cannon|MAC]] systems—one on each side of its main fuselage.{{Ref/Reuse|Enc22}} Some ''Diligence''-class destroyers were operated by the [[Colonial Military Authority]] as peacekeeping ships,{{Ref/Reuse|CFClarity}}, seeing active use within the CMA Navy for over a century.{{Ref/Reuse|Enc22}} By [[2525]], the class had been retired for decades. In [[2544]],{{Ref/Site|Id=CFShocks|URL=https://www.halowaypoint.com/news/canon-fodder-system-shocks|Site=Halo Waypoint|Page=Canon Fodder - System Shocks|D=30|M=06|Y=2023}} a ''Diligence''-class destroyer, the {{UNSCShip|Kronstadt}}, deployed a squad of [[Orbital Drop Shock Troopers]] and a [[SPARTAN-II program|SPARTAN-II commando]], [[Cal-141]], via [[M8900 drop pod|M8900 SOEIV]] to the Covenant-occupied planet [[Heian]]. The commando team infiltrated a former alien settlement, where they engaged several [[Unggoy]] and a [[Jiralhanae]] [[Unidentified Jiralhanae chieftain (Heian)|chieftain]] before assassinating a Covenant [[Unidentified Prophet (Heian)|Prophet]]. After the mission, which resulted in the deaths of the Spartan and [[Checkman|one ODST]], the vessel retrieved the survivors.{{Ref/Reuse|Babysitter}}{{Ref/Reuse|CFClarity}} | |||
